The Resurgence of 'Baby Boy'

First off, why 'Baby Boy' in 2022? This isn't just a random song choice, you know? 'Baby Boy', released in 2003, was a massive hit. It was a global anthem, dominating airwaves and charts worldwide. Featuring Sean Paul, the track blended R&B with a reggae influence, creating a unique and irresistible sound. The song’s success cemented Beyoncé's status as a solo artist, distinct from her Destiny's Child days.
